Eureka参数配置->Server端参数

1、基本参数

参数默认值说明
eureka.server.enable-self-preservation
true是否开启自我保护模式
eureka.server.renewal-percent-threshold
0.85指定每分钟需要收到的续约次数的阀值
eureka.instance.registry.expected-number-of-renews-per-min(已过时)
1指定每分钟需要收到的续约次数值,实际该值在其中被写死为count*2,另外也会被更新
eureka.server.renewal-threshold-update-interval-ms
15分钟指定updateRenewalThreshold定时任务的调度频率来动态更新expectedNumber OfRenewsPerMin、numberOfRenewsPerMinThreshold值
eureka.server.eviction-interval-timer-in-ms
60*1000指定EvictionTask定时任务的调度频率,用于剔除过期的实例

2、response cache参数(Eureka Server为了提升自身REST API接口的性能,提供了两个缓存,一个是基于ConcurrentMap的readOnlyCacheMap,一个是基于Guava Cache的readWriteCacheMap)

参数默认值说明
eureka.server.use-read-only-response-cache
true是否使用只读的response-cache
eureka.server.response-cache-update-interval-ms
30*1000设置CacheUpdateTask的调度时间间隔,用于从readWriteCacheMap更新数据到readOnlyCacheMap,仅仅在eureka.server.use-read-only-response-cache为true的时候才生效
eureka.server.response-cache-auto-expiration-in-seconds
180设置readWriteCacheMap的expireAfterWrite参数,指定写入多长时间后过期

3、peer相关参数

参数默认值说明
eureka.server.peer-eureka-nodes-update-interval-ms
10分钟指定peersUpdateTask调度的时间间隔,用于从配置文件刷新peerEurekaNodes节点的配置信息(eureka.client.serviceUrl相关zone的配置)
eureka.server.peer-eureka-status-refresh-time-interval-ms
30*1000指定更新peer nodes状态信息的时间间隔

4、http参数

参数默认值说明
eureka.server.peer-node-connect-timeout-ms
200连接超时时间
eureka.server.peer-node-read-timeout-ms
200读超时时间
eureka.server.peer-node-total-connections
1000连接池最大活动连接数(MaxTotal)
eureka.server.peer-node-total-connections-per-host
500每个host能使用的最大连接数(DefaultMaxPerRoute)
eureka.server.peer-node-connection-idle-timeout-seconds
30连接池中连接的空闲时间(connectionIdleTimeout)

转载于:https://www.cnblogs.com/idoljames/p/11487750.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值